Nifedipine for Hypertension: Does it Work?

Hypertension, commonly known as high blood pressure, is a prevalent health condition that requires careful management. {Nifedipine, a calcium channel blocker, is frequently prescribed to control blood pressure. It functions by relaxing and widening the blood vessels, thereby decreasing the resistance of blood flow through them. Studies have demonstrated that nifedipine can effectively reduce systolic and diastolic blood pressure in most patients with hypertension. The Benefits and Risks of Nifedipine Therapy

Nifedipine is a calcium channel blocker commonly prescribed to treat high blood pressure or chest pain. It can effectively reduce blood pressure by relaxing blood vessels which boosts blood flow. Nifedipine may also ease angina symptoms by increasing oxygen supply to the heart muscle. It is essential to be aware of nifedipine may present certain risks including headaches, dizziness, and swelling in the legs and ankles. In some cases, nifedipine might lead to more significant side effects, including an irregular heartbeat or flushing. Common Side Effects of Nifedipine: What You Need to Know

Nifedipine may cause a variety of side effects. The intensity of these side effects varies from person to person. Some common side effects include dizziness, flushings in the face and neck, edema in the ankles and feet, and rapid heart rate. In some cases, nifedipine may also result in more significant side effects such as angina, respiratory distress, and drop in blood pressure.
